Hi sales leads — quick rundown before planning week. The franchise deal with Oakbarrel Coffee for the Tresmont corridor is nearly inked: 6% royalty, shared local marketing fund, and a two-site minimum in year one. What this means for you: their territory will be carved out of direct sales, so adjust pipeline forecasts accordingly. Lena will circulate revised quota sheets once signatures land. Expect a short transition period with some account handoffs. One confidential item needs to sit right below this note.

board note of tawig-bajof: The renewal with Ralixix Holdings closes at $10 million a year, 20 percent above the last contract. Project Druix slips by two quarters because of the tooling delay.

# Artifact Signing — Feedwarden Validator

Every Feedwarden release artifact must carry a valid detached signature before publication. The CI pipeline signs builds automatically after tests pass; manual signing is prohibited. New team members should verify each download locally before installing, without exception. Rotation occurs annually and is announced in advance. The current signing key is listed below.

deploy key for yajop-fahop: bky3_h1v

Hey plugin authors,

Small but important one: Ledgerbee 4.1 adds a tax-rate lookup cache, so repeated lookups in the same checkout no longer hammer the rates service. If your plugin mutates rates mid-transaction, call the new invalidate hook or you'll serve stale numbers. Docs are updated in the dev portal. Please test against the staging build tagged with the token below.

pipeline stamp: htk9_ce63042d9

Hi support team,

The cut-over on the Marletta orders table completed this morning. Hard deletes are now disabled; rows instead receive a deleted_at timestamp and vanish from standard queries via the new view layer. Historical orders were backfilled, and the nightly purge job now archives anything soft-deleted for more than ninety days. If a customer reports a "missing" order, check the deleted_at column before escalating. For troubleshooting, the service is currently running with the following configuration values.

settings of yageg-yahap:
[gorael]
team = olieth
access_code = ac_941d74
owner = brieth.aldiel
host = gorael.tolvaqio.internal
port = 6379
peer = briwyn.urlaqtech.internal
salt = 116e6622
pin = 1957